U.S. President Donald Trump addressed the riots in Los Angeles protesting migrant deportations, writing on his Truth Social platform that "Los Angeles, once a great American city, has been invaded by illegal immigrants and criminals who have seized it. Now, an angry, violent, and rebellious mob is attacking federal agents and trying to stop the deportation of migrants - but this mob only strengthens our determination to act. I am directing Secretary of Homeland Security Kristy Noem, Defense Secretary Pete Hagerty, and Attorney General Pam Bondi to work together to liberate Los Angeles."
